Hot Composting & Permaculture 20th August 2022
Location: Ansa Permaculture Design, Ballingeary Co. Cork, Ireland
Saturday
20th August 2022
10am – 16.30pm
Join Paul Lynch for a workshop on the theory and practice of hot composting. We will build a new pile together and turn “one we made earlier” so that participants get the full experience of the power of hot composting when it’s hot! Complimentary tea, coffee and light lunch included. We’ll also see how to use the finished product in a tour of an intentionally designed permaculture garden and touch on some permaculture design principles.
Here is an article and video showing the process: https://permaculturedesign.ie/hot-composting/
Course topics:
- Why hot compost? A miracle of transformation
- Hot composting benefits vs cold composting
- Composting materials and carbon to nitrogen ratios
- Material preparation and moisture
- How to build a good pile
- Turning a hot pile
- Use of compost and permaculture garden tour

Summer Pruning & Orchard Care 13th August 2022
Location: Ansa Permaculture Design, Ballingeary Co. Cork, Ireland
Saturday
13th of August 2022
10:00am – 16.30pm
Join Paul Lynch for a workshop on the theory and demonstration of orchard care from a permaculture perspective, focusing on summer apple pruning. Complimentary tea, coffee and light lunch included.
Here is an article introducing the subject: https://permaculturedesign.ie/orchard-pruning-cork/
Course topics:
- Why prune at all?
- The natural shape of an apple tree
- The purpose of grafting, its effects and side-effects
- Summer pruning vs winter pruning
- Vegetative and fruiting wood
- Orchard guilds and design considerations
- Pollination
- Tools and tool care
- Disease pruning
- Summer pruning demo
